Public Schedule for the Week of May 4-8, 2009
May 6, Governor Lingle will discuss state issues on her monthly radio show with host Rick Hamada from 7:05 - 8:00 a.m. HST. Listeners are invited to call 808-521-8383 from O`ahu or 888-565-8383 from the Neighbor Islands with questions and comments. The show can be heard live statewide on O`ahu (KHVH 830 AM), Maui (KAOI 1110 AM), Hilo (KPUA 670 AM), and Kaua`i (KQNG 570 AM).
May 6, Governor Lingle will participate in the dedication of the Senior Residence at Kapolei, a 60-unit affordable rental housing project for seniors. The event will also include a groundbreaking ceremony for the Senior Residence at Kapolei 2, which will add 20 more affordable rental housing units for seniors.
May 7, Governor Lingle will join the University of Hawai`i and the University of Hawai`i Alumni Association in honoring the 2009 recipients of the Distinguished Alumni Award: Dr. Chiyome Fukino (MD '79), director, Hawai`i State Department of Health; Dr. James (MA '69) and Dr. Lois Horton (MA '69), historians and visiting professors in American Studies; Dee Jay Mailer (BS '75, MBA '85), chief executive officer, Kamehameha Schools; and Sabrina McKenna (BA '78, JD '82), lawyer and jurist.
